Janaria
jah-NAH-ree-ah
Janaria is a girl’s name of English origin, meaning “Janaria is a modern invented name with no definitive meaning, but likely related to variations on 'Jane' or 'Jan'.”. It currently ranks #11501 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2009.
What Janaria Means
“Janaria is a modern invented name with no definitive meaning, but likely related to variations on 'Jane' or 'Jan'.”
